Council advances lease‑revenue bond ordinance for Park Place and Jefferson Park to second reading
South Charleston City Council · April 16, 2026

The council voted to move to second reading an ordinance authorizing up to $45,000,000 in lease‑revenue refunding bonds for the Park Place and Jefferson Park projects, after a staff reading of the ordinance title and scope.
The South Charleston City Council voted to advance to a second reading an ordinance authorizing the refunding of lease‑revenue bonds issued by the South Charleston Municipal Building Commission for the Park Place and Jefferson Park projects.
